More Summer Party Ideas

Of course, a great invitation is just the first step in planning a memorable summer party. If you’re looking for more ideas and inspiration to make your event a success, then check out some of these fun and festive summer party themes:

  • Beach Bash: If you live near the coast or have access to a beach, then why not host a beach bash? Set up some games, volleyball nets, and beach towels, and encourage your guests to bring their swimsuits and sunscreen for a day of fun in the sun.
  • Backyard BBQ: There’s nothing quite like a classic backyard barbecue to get everyone in the summer spirit. Fire up the grill, serve up some hot dogs and burgers, and decorate your patio or deck with some festive summer decorations.
  • Fiesta Time: Spice things up with a fiesta-themed party! Serve up some delicious Mexican food and drinks, play some lively music, and decorate with bright colors and papel picado banners.
  • Picnic in the Park: A picnic in the park is a great way to enjoy the outdoors and soak up some sunshine. Pack some sandwiches and snacks, bring a frisbee or a ball, and enjoy the company of friends and family in a beautiful setting.
  • Lawn Games Tournament: If you’re looking for a fun and competitive party theme, then why not host a lawn games tournament? Set up some classic games like cornhole, ladder toss, and bocce ball, and award prizes for the winners.

Inviting Your Guests

Once you’ve settled on a party theme and created your invitation, it’s time to start inviting your guests. Remember, the more advanced notice you give your guests, the better chance they have of attending your party. When sending out your invitations, make sure to include all the important details, such as:

  • Date and time
  • Location and address
  • RSVP information
  • Any special instructions or requests (such as bringing your own lawn chairs or contributing to a potluck dish)

You may also want to include a fun or catchy phrase to get your guests excited about the party. For example, “Join us for some fun in the sun!” or “Let’s kick off summer in style!”

Preparing for Your Party

Once your invitations are sent out and your guests have RSVP’d, it’s time to start preparing for your summer party. Here are a few tips to help make sure your event goes smoothly:

  • Make a checklist: Write down everything you need to do before the party, such as buying groceries, setting up decorations, and cleaning the house.
  • Delegate tasks: Don’t be afraid to ask for help! Assign tasks to family members or friends, such as manning the grill or setting up tables and chairs.
  • Prepare plenty of food and drinks: Make sure you have enough food and beverages on hand to accommodate all of your guests. Consider setting up a buffet-style table or a self-serve bar to make things easier.
  • Plan for bad weather: If your party is outdoors, be sure to have a backup plan in case of rain or other inclement weather. Have a tent or awning on standby, or move the party indoors if necessary.
  • Have fun!: Don’t forget to relax and enjoy yourself! Your guests will have a great time if they see that you are having fun too.
